£27,345 + Local Government Pension + 38 Days Holiday + Excellent Training & Career Development + 37-Hour Week

Are you an experienced Caretaker, Facilities Assistant, Maintenance Operative or Site Officer looking for a varied role with excellent job security and work-life balance?

Do you want to join a leading Further Education college where you'll play a key role in maintaining a safe, welcoming environment while enjoying long-term career development and an outstanding benefits package?

This well-established college has an excellent reputation for delivering high-quality education while providing a safe and supportive environment for both students and staff.

Investing heavily in its facilities and employees, the college offers ongoing training, genuine career progression and the opportunity to be part of a close-knit Estates team.

In this varied role, you will be responsible for the day-to-day maintenance, security and smooth operation of the college campus.

You'll carry out general building maintenance, complete planned and reactive repairs, undertake site safety and compliance checks, support room set-ups, assist with deliveries and help ensure the campus remains safe, secure and welcoming for students, staff and visitors.

You'll also work closely with the Reception and Estates teams, supporting site security, monitoring CCTV, carrying out building lock-up and unlock procedures, and responding to out-of-hours call-outs on a rota basis.

The ideal candidate will have previous experience within caretaking, facilities, estates or general building maintenance.

You'll have excellent practical DIY skills, a strong customer-focused approach and enjoy working as part of a team.

An SIA Licence is desirable, although training can be provided for the right candidate.

The Role

  • Carry out planned and reactive building maintenance across the campus
  • Complete general DIY repairs including painting, basic plumbing, carpentry and maintenance tasks
  • Undertake routine health & safety and compliance checks
  • Monitor site security, CCTV and access control
  • Support reception duties, deliveries and room set-ups
  • Carry out building lock-up and unlock procedures
  • Participate in an on-call rota, including occasional evenings and weekends
  • Work across college campuses when required
  • Full-time, 37-hour week
  • The Person
  • Experience within caretaking, facilities, estates or building maintenance
  • Strong practical DIY skills with knowledge of general maintenance
  • Excellent customer service and communication skills
  • SIA Licence or willingness to obtain one
  • First Aid qualification or willingness to undertake training
  • Full UK Driving Licence
  • Happy to work a rotating shift pattern, including occasional evenings and weekends
